Ripatransone is a comune (municipality) in the Province of Ascoli Piceno in the Italian region Marche, located about 80 kilometres (50 mi) south of Ancona and about 20 kilometres (12 mi) south of Ascoli Piceno.
Tivoli is a town and comune in the Lazio region of central Italy. It is located about 24 kilometres (15 mi) east-northeast of Rome, on the slopes of the Monti Tiburtini, overlooking the Aniene Valley.

Where to Go
There are a number of places worth visiting in Tivoli, including:
- Villa Adriana: A UNESCO World Heritage Site, this villa was once the home of Emperor Hadrian.
- Villa d'Este: Another UNESCO World Heritage Site, this villa is famous for its beautiful gardens and fountains.
- Temple of Vesta: A Roman temple dedicated to the goddess Vesta.
